Kuyini ukwelashwa kwe-ultraviolet?
Le yindlela yokuphulukisa, lapho ukusabela kuqhutshwa ukukhanya kwe-UV ukwenza lukhuni noma ukwenza i-polymerize into ewuketshezi - okungukuthi, ukunamathela, inki, noma ukumbozwa - kube okuqinile. Lokhu kungafani nenqubo yokushisa, lapho inqubo yokuphulukisa i-UV isebenzisa amandla okukhanya ukuvuselela umsebenzi wama-photoinitiators, ngaleyo ndlela kubangele i-polymerization esheshayo. Le nqubo ibizwa nangokuthi i-photopolymerization, futhi isuselwa ekusetshenzisweni kwama-wavelengths athile e-UV (imvamisa i-365nm, 385nm, 395nm, ne-405nm). Ubude be-wavelength bunquma ukujula kokuphulukisa, isivinini, nokuhambisana kwezinto zokwakha. Ngokuyisisekelo, ukuphulukiswa kwe-UV kuyindlela yokuphulukisa esebenza ngamandla futhi engaxhunyiwe enikeza isenzo sokuphulukisa esibikezelwa ngaphandle kokusonteka kwezinto ezibucayi.
Inqubo Yokuphulukisa ye-UV ichaziwe
Indlela ye-UV yokwelapha iqukethe izingxenye ezintathu ezinkulu:
Umthombo wokukhanya kwe-UV - Imvamisa iyimodyuli yesibani se-LED noma isibani se-mercury esikhipha imisebe ye-ultraviolet elawulwayo.
I-Photoinitiator - Le yinto esebenzayo yesithombe efakwe ekunamathiseleni noma ekuhlanganisweni okuvezwe emisebeni ye-UV futhi yenza ukunamathela kube nzima.
Ama-Monomers / ama-Polymers asebenzayo - yilawo asetshenziselwa ukwakha iwebhu eqinile ngesikhathi senqubo yokuphulukisa nge-UV crosslinking.
Lapho ukukhanya kwe-UV kushaya ubuso bezinto ezibonakalayo, kubangela inqubo yokusebenza kwe-photoinitiator. Lokhu kukhiqiza ama-radicals wamahhala abangela ukuxhumana kwamakhemikhali kwama-monomers ukwakha ama-polymers, akha indawo eqinile, eqinile cishe ngokushesha.
Technical Insights UV Curing
- Ubuchwepheshe bokwelapha i-UV bulawulwa ekukhishweni kokukhanya nokudluliswa kwamandla.
- Inani lamandla ebusweni libalwa nge-UV irradiance (kulinganiswa ku-mW / cm2).
- Isikhathi sokuvezwa nokukhethwa kwe-wavelength (365nm-405nm) kunomthelela ekujuleni kwe-polymer nokunamathela.
- Amamojula we-LED array avumela ukusatshalaliswa okufanayo kokukhanya ukuze kube nokulawula okuhle kokuphulukisa.
Izinhlelo zokuphathwa zokushisa nazo ziyakwazi ukuvimbela ukushisa ngokweqile ngakho-ke zigcina ukushisa ezingeni eliphansi, ngaleyo ndlela zivimbele isenzo sokushisa ama-substrates abucayi.
Izinhlelo zanamuhla nazo zine-reflector optics kanye namasinki okushisa azinzisa ukusebenza kwezinhlelo futhi aqinisekise ukuthi angagcinwa ngamandla e-UV njalo. Le nhlanganisela ye-physics nobunjiniyela yenza ukwelashwa kwe-UV kungasheshi kuphela kodwa futhi kunokwethenjelwa kakhulu ngokuya ngokukhiqiza ngamavolumu amakhulu.

Ukukhetha isibani sokuphulukisa se-UV noma uhlelo
Lapho ukhetha isibani esifanele kakhulu sokuphulukisa i-UV, kuyafaneleka ukukhumbula ukuthi:
Uhlobo lwezinto ezibonakalayo: Ngokuya ngama-adhesives, ukumbozwa / uyinki kungadinga ama-wavelengths athile e-UV.
Indawo Yokuphulukisa: Vumelanisa indawo yendawo ehambisanayo. Qhathanisa isibani endaweni ye-substrate ngendlela yokuthi imiphumela izohlala ifana.
Ukuzwela ukushisa: ukuzwela. Kufanele kube amasistimu we-UV LED ashisa kakhulu.
Ukonga amandla: Thola izinhlelo ezinemisebe ye-UV futhi ezilawulwa ngamandla.
Uhlelo lokupholisa: Ukuqinisekisa ukuzinza ezimweni lapho umshini uzosetshenziswa isikhathi eside, umshini upholile ngamanzi.
